The precision agriculture market has gained tremendous impetus from the increased commercial viability of drone technologies. Drones will be supporting the farmers in a wide range of tasks from forecasting and planning to the actual cultivation of the crops in the forthcoming years. This will subsequently aid in supervising the fields to make sure that the crops grown are healthy. Additionally, the concepts of Agriculture 4.0 and advancements in the GPS technologies are poised to revolutionize the global precision farming market, which was worth $5.2 billion at the end of 2018 and the revenue avenues are estimated to increment at a notable CAGR of 14% during the forecast period of 2019 to 2025.

The world’s population is anticipated to grow to almost 10 billion in 2050. The elevation of the demographics will lead to an increase in the production of 70% more crops by 2050. The high growth can be attributed to the escalation of the use of advanced analytics and the Internet of things (IoT) by farmers. North America Leading the Precision Agriculture Market

In 2018, North America led the global precision agriculture market revenue with a regional share of 33.6%. Numerous government initiatives are being taken by the government for the development of infrastructure and the adoption of modern agriculture technologies. The Canadian government took an initiative to help its farmers in November 2016. The government invested $42 million in the Clean Seed Capital Group Ltd. to commercialize and enhance the precision agriculture technology. The objective behind the investment was to decrease the use of the excessive amount of pesticides and fertilizers. This investment led to the development of CX-6 SMART Seeder equipment for the farmers, due to this farming became an easy process for them. Similar initiatives by the government and the major players are persuading the growth of the precision agriculture market.

Variable Rate and Soil Monitoring Applications Gaining Tremendous Traction

Variable rate and soil monitoring are the fast-growing and the most developing segments of the precision agriculture market. Variable rate application (VRA) is a range of technology that in a given landscape it only focuses on the automated application of materials. These materials such as fertilizers, seeds, and chemicals are used based on the data collected by GPS, maps, and sensors. Furthermore, soil monitoring application is the crux of the precision farming revolution in this era. These monitoring sensors are cost-effective, smaller in size, and easier to use. Because of this, farmers have begun deploying them in greater numbers to acquire more dynamic and precise picture to understand what is happening in the land.
